Sample Sign Requirements in Vandalia
| Sign Type | Max Height | Max Area | Setback |
|---|---|---|---|
| Flag | 24 ft (residential districts), 35 ft (nonresidential districts) | — | — |
| Temporary Sign | — | — | At least 10 ft from pavement and outside right-of-way |
| Residential Sign | — | 6 sq ft per sign face | — |
